Directions
1. Prepare the Marinara Sauce
In a saucepan, heat a tablespoon of olive oil over medium heat. Add minced garlic and sauté until fragrant. Stir in crushed tomatoes, oregano, sugar, salt, and pepper. Simmer for about 15-20 minutes, then stir in chopped fresh basil.
2. Bread the Mozzarella
Slice the fresh mozzarella into 1/2 inch thick slices. Set up a breading station with three shallow bowls: one with flour, one with beaten eggs, and one with breadcrumbs mixed with salt and pepper.
3. Fry the Mozzarella
Dip each mozzarella slice in flour, then in egg, and finally coat with breadcrumbs. In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ium-high heat. Fry the breaded mozzarella slices until golden brown on both sides, about 2-3 minutes per side. Remove and drain on paper towels.
4. Serve
Place fried mozzarella slices over a bed of warm marinara sauce. Garnish with fresh basil and serve immediately.
